planting poppy seed

I just received a packet of California poppy seed. Can I plant them now (Sept) in Illinois?

Direct sow your seeds outside in early spring. Prepare the area by raking loose the top few inches of soil, plant the seeds and cover lightly (only about 1/8 in. deep). Keep the soil moist after planting until the seeds germinate in 14 – 28 days, depending on the temperature.
